About carboxy hydrogen carbonate;5-[8-chloro-6-morpholin-4-yl-9-(2,2,2-trifluoroethyl)purin-2-yl]pyrimidin-2-amine

carboxy hydrogen carbonate;5-[8-chloro-6-morpholin-4-yl-9-(2,2,2-trifluoroethyl)purin-2-yl]pyrimidin-2-amine (PubChem CID 89145543) has the molecular formula C17H16ClF3N8O6 and a molecular weight of 520.81 g/mol. Its IUPAC name is carboxy hydrogen carbonate;5-[8-chloro-6-morpholin-4-yl-9-(2,2,2-trifluoroethyl)purin-2-yl]pyrimidin-2-amine.
